X-Ray crystal structure of a vinyllithium–tetrahydrofuran solvate (C2H3Li–thf)4. Quantitative estimation of Li–H distances by 6Li–1H HOESY

Abstract

Vinyllithium crystallizes with one equivalent of tetrahydrofuran (thf) and is tetrameric in the solid state whereas in thf solution a tetramer–dimer equilibrium (8: 1, 2.0 mol dm–3, –90 °C) is present; lithium–hydrogen distances in solution are derived quantitatively by 6Li–1H HOESY with ca. 0.2 Å accuracy.
